Overview
Volt is immediately hiring for
Founding Engineer (Full Stack or Backend w/Python)
in
San Francisco, CA
As a
Founding Engineer
you will work closely with the client's CTO to build their product from the ground up. Be a champion for user experience, incorporating a deep understanding of our users to guide design decisions alongside the founding team.
Set the foundational system architecture and select key technologies for the codebase.
Help us build additional recruiting agents and deliver on our technical and product roadmap.
Help establish engineering best practices and standards within the team. Mentor junior engineers and contribute to a culture of technical excellence.
This Founding Engineer is required to come onsite in San Francisco, CA office of the client 5 Days a week.
Duties
5+ years of experience as a software engineer. Experience with zero-to-one development: You should have built new products or systems from the ground up. Deep appreciation for and commitment to delivering outstanding user experiences. Exceptional communication skills and a proven ability to work cross-functionally. Comfortable with the pace and ambiguity of a fast-growing startup environment. Degree in Computer Science or a related engineering field with a GPA of 3.9 Minimum Nice to Have
Our client is looking for backend and AI engineers, so ideally you will have deep experience in one of those domains. However, the ability to move around the stack into new areas as needed is appreciated. Experience with some of the technologies in our stack: Python, GRPC, Kubernetes, React, Typescript, Azure and Terraform. Early-stage experience at a startup. Experience building applied AI products.
